一千萬個為什麽

搜索

Zend框架技術

我正在嘗試遷移到zend框架。每個網頁應該是一個控制器還是一個動作。

有多種行動的優勢是什麽。他們可以相互交談嗎?以及Action助手和View助手的最佳用途是什麽。

請指導我如何開始框架..謝謝

最佳答案

您可以為每個頁面使用新控制器,也可以在同一控制器上定義多個操作來呈現頁面。我選擇使用來自同一控制器的不同動作來顯示variuos頁面。在同一個控制器上使用多個動作可以讓你在每個動作執行的控制器的che構造函數中放置一些代碼。例如,我有一個控制器用於網站的所有pulic頁面和一個新的控制器,用於保留給註冊用戶的那些頁面。在專用於註冊用戶的控制器的構造函數中,我執行了身份驗證檢查。

轉載註明原文: Zend框架技術